news 2026/5/1 11:44:19

三步掌握百度网盘命令行工具:高效管理文件的终极指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
三步掌握百度网盘命令行工具:高效管理文件的终极指南

三步掌握百度网盘命令行工具:高效管理文件的终极指南

【免费下载链接】BaiduPCS-Goiikira/BaiduPCS-Go原版基础上集成了分享链接/秒传链接转存功能项目地址: https://gitcode.com/GitHub_Trending/ba/BaiduPCS-Go

百度网盘命令行客户端是一款基于Go语言开发的高效工具,它让你摆脱图形界面的束缚,通过命令行快速管理网盘中的文件。无论是批量操作、自动化脚本还是远程服务器管理,这款工具都能显著提升你的工作效率。本文将带你从零开始,通过准备工作、部署步骤和实战操作三个阶段,全面掌握这个强大工具的使用方法。

一、准备工作:搭建Go语言开发环境 🛠️

在开始使用百度网盘命令行客户端之前,我们需要先搭建Go语言开发环境。这款工具基于Go语言开发,因此正确配置Go环境是确保顺利运行的前提。

1.1 安装Go语言

根据你的操作系统,选择以下安装方式:

Windows系统

  1. 访问Go语言官网下载适用于Windows的安装包
  2. 运行安装包,按照向导完成安装
  3. 打开命令提示符,输入以下命令验证安装:
    go version

macOS系统: 使用Homebrew快速安装:

brew install go

Linux系统: 对于Ubuntu/Debian系统:

sudo apt-get update && sudo apt-get install golang-go

1.2 配置环境变量

安装完成后,需要配置GOPATH环境变量:

# Linux/macOS系统,添加到~/.bashrc或~/.zshrc export GOPATH=$HOME/go export PATH=$PATH:$GOPATH/bin # Windows系统,在系统环境变量中添加 # GOPATH: C:\Users\你的用户名\go # 在PATH中添加 %GOPATH%\bin

二、部署步骤:快速安装百度网盘命令行工具 🚀

2.1 通过源码编译安装

  1. 克隆项目仓库到本地:

    git clone https://gitcode.com/GitHub_Trending/ba/BaiduPCS-Go cd BaiduPCS-Go
  2. 编译项目源码:

    go build
  3. 编译完成后,当前目录会生成名为BaiduPCS-Go的可执行文件

2.2 配置系统PATH(可选)

为了能在任意目录下运行该工具,可以将可执行文件移动到系统PATH目录中:

# Linux/macOS系统 sudo cp BaiduPCS-Go /usr/local/bin/ # Windows系统 move BaiduPCS-Go C:\Windows\System32\

三、实战操作:百度网盘命令行基础用法 💻

3.1 登录百度账号

使用以下命令登录百度网盘账号:

BaiduPCS-Go login -bduss=<你的BDUSS值>

提示:BDUSS值可以通过浏览器登录百度网盘后,从Cookie中获取

3.2 文件列表查看

查看当前目录下的文件和文件夹:

BaiduPCS-Go ls

查看指定目录内容:

BaiduPCS-Go ls /我的资源/学习资料

3.3 文件下载

下载单个文件:

BaiduPCS-Go download /文档/工作汇报.docx

下载文件夹:

BaiduPCS-Go download -r /图片/旅行照片

3.4 文件上传

上传本地文件到网盘:

BaiduPCS-Go upload ./本地文件.txt /我的文档/

3.5 目录切换

在网盘内切换工作目录:

BaiduPCS-Go cd /我的视频

四、进阶技巧:提升效率的高级命令 ⚡

4.1 秒传链接转存

利用秒传链接快速保存文件到网盘,无需等待上传:

BaiduPCS-Go rapidupload "https://pan.baidu.com/s/1xxxxxx"

4.2 文件搜索

在网盘中快速搜索文件:

BaiduPCS-Go search "年度报告"

可以指定搜索路径和文件类型:

BaiduPCS-Go search -p /文档 -t doc "财务报表"

4.3 批量文件操作

同时移动多个文件:

BaiduPCS-Go mv /临时文件/*.txt /归档文件/

批量删除文件:

BaiduPCS-Go rm /过时资料/*.zip

五、注意事项与常见问题 ⚠️

使用百度网盘命令行工具时,请注意以下几点:

  1. 保持网络连接稳定,特别是在进行大文件传输时
  2. 避免频繁执行大量API请求,以免触发百度网盘的请求限制
  3. 敏感操作前建议备份重要数据
  4. 如果遇到登录问题,请检查BDUSS是否过期,重新获取并更新

通过本文介绍的内容,你已经掌握了百度网盘命令行工具的基本使用方法和进阶技巧。这款强大的工具将帮助你更高效地管理百度网盘中的文件,无论是日常使用还是自动化脚本编写,都能为你带来极大的便利。开始探索吧,体验命令行带来的高效与自由!

【免费下载链接】BaiduPCS-Goiikira/BaiduPCS-Go原版基础上集成了分享链接/秒传链接转存功能项目地址: https://gitcode.com/GitHub_Trending/ba/BaiduPCS-Go

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/1 3:55:00

小白也能懂的Android 8.0开机启动脚本保姆级教程

小白也能懂的Android 8.0开机启动脚本保姆级教程 你是不是也遇到过这样的问题&#xff1a;想让自己的程序在Android设备一开机就自动运行&#xff0c;比如自动开启某个服务、设置系统属性、或者执行一些初始化操作&#xff1f;但一看到“init.rc”“SELinux”“te文件”这些词…

作者头像 李华
网站建设 2026/4/30 19:11:33

突破限制:macOS虚拟机解锁技术全攻略与实战指南

突破限制&#xff1a;macOS虚拟机解锁技术全攻略与实战指南 【免费下载链接】unlocker VMware Workstation macOS 项目地址: https://gitcode.com/gh_mirrors/un/unlocker 虚拟化困境的破局之道&#xff1a;为什么我们需要解锁技术 作为技术探索者&#xff0c;你是否曾…

作者头像 李华
网站建设 2026/4/30 22:45:06

大语言模型的知识冲突:成因、根源与展望

大语言模型在实际应用场景中经常面临知识冲突的问题&#xff0c;主要包括上下文 - 记忆知识冲突、多源上下文知识冲突和记忆内知识冲突。 本文首先从训练数据的局限性、模型问题&#xff0c;以及外部信息缺陷三个方面深入分析知识冲突的成因&#xff1b;随后进一步探讨了知识冲…

作者头像 李华
网站建设 2026/4/8 14:30:05

探索Windows安卓应用安装新方式:无需模拟器的跨平台体验

探索Windows安卓应用安装新方式&#xff1a;无需模拟器的跨平台体验 【免费下载链接】APK-Installer An Android Application Installer for Windows 项目地址: https://gitcode.com/GitHub_Trending/ap/APK-Installer 你是否曾遇到这样的困扰&#xff1a;想在电脑上使用…

作者头像 李华
网站建设 2026/5/1 5:03:51

2026年一键降AI工具排行:懒人必备的5款效率神器

2026年一键降AI工具排行&#xff1a;懒人必备的5款效率神器 TL;DR&#xff1a;不想花时间手动改论文&#xff1f;一键降AI工具帮你搞定。本文排行5款效率最高的降AI工具&#xff1a;嘎嘎降AI&#xff08;4.8元/千字&#xff0c;2-5分钟出结果&#xff09;、比话降AI&#xff08…

作者头像 李华
网站建设 2026/5/1 5:01:18

零门槛实战:用ollama-python构建本地AI自定义应用

零门槛实战&#xff1a;用ollama-python构建本地AI自定义应用 【免费下载链接】ollama-python 项目地址: https://gitcode.com/GitHub_Trending/ol/ollama-python 在数字化时代&#xff0c;本地AI应用正成为保护数据隐私的重要选择。你是否曾因云服务的隐私风险而却步&…

作者头像 李华